🛠️ Как быстро анализировать логи Linux и не потеряться в потоке данных
Привет, искатели идеального uptime! 🚀
Знаешь ли, что правильное понимание логов — это как иметь суперспособность системного аналитика? А если знать, как быстро находить важную информацию — проблема с долгими дебагами исчезает сама собой!
Вот твой краткий гайд по логам:
- Используй journalctl для просмотра системных журналов, фильтрации по уровню ошибок или времени:
- Для текущей сессии — journalctl -xe
- Чтобы найти ошибки за последние 10 минут — journalctl --since "10 min ago"
- tail -f /var/log/syslog помогает следить за реальным временем — идеально для диагностики в моменте.
- Не забывай grep, чтобы искать по ключевым словам, например, grep "error" /var/log/nginx/error.log
- Для просмотра и поиска по конкретному приложению используй journalctl -u nginx.service или docker logs <container>
- Автоматизация и фильтрация? Можно запомнить команды типа:
- journalctl | grep 'timeout' | tail -20
Запомни: правильный анализ — это не тратил время, а направленный поиск нужных моментов.
А как ты обычно ищешь важные строки в логах? Делишься своими лайфхаками?
Прокачай свои скилы в телеграм канале https://t.me/LinuxSkill а пройти тесты на знание linux в боте https://t.me/gradeliftbot
📩 Завтра: Мастерство: как настроить мониторинг с нуля за 10 минут!
Включи 🔔 чтобы не пропустить!